CI note for on-call: the FleetSum fuel-usage report job has been flaking on the nightly pipeline since Monday. The aggregation step times out when the Dunmore depot dataset exceeds roughly two million rows, and the retry wrapper masks the failure until the artifact upload stage. Workaround: re-run the job with the reduced-window flag and verify the report lands in the staging bucket before 06:00. A permanent fix is tracked by the Haulpoint team. The failing pipeline run corresponds to the identifier below.

pipeline stamp: htk31_f769b577b3028a4e9958e5bb8d1259a

**Q: Does the Marrowfield admin dashboard support dark mode?**

Yes, since release 3.2. Theme tokens live in `themes/dusk.json`; do not hardcode colors elsewhere, as contrast ratios are audited quarterly. Legacy pages fall back to light mode intentionally. To regenerate the signed theme bundle, unlock the build keystore using the recovery passphrase below.

unlock words, yawig-kagef: gordor-holvan-ulaael-pramir-ulaiel-tamdor

# Build Provenance: Zero-Downtime Schema Migrations

Support team: every Harbormill migration ships in two phases — expand (add columns, backfill) and contract (drop old columns) — so the app never sees a missing field. If a customer reports mixed-schema errors, check whether both phases ran; a half-applied migration is the usual culprit. Each deployed migration is traceable to the build stamped below.

build token for yajof-bajof: htk31_506ff1188f74596b5bb2eec94edc43c